Desenvolva com a API PrintKK

Comece com autenticação por assinatura e implemente upload de imagens, criação de designs, criação de pedidos e processamento de pagamentos via endpoints REST.

Principais funcionalidades da API

Concentre-se no fluxo de produção essencial, desde ativos até pagamento, com base nos grupos de endpoints documentados.

Assinatura e autenticação

Use as especificações de assinatura e autenticação para proteger cada solicitação e controlar o acesso às suas operações de API.

Fazer upload de imagens

Faça upload de ativos de design através dos endpoints de imagem e prepare arquivos para geração de designs downstream.

Criar designs

Crie dados de design com os endpoints de design e organize os parâmetros necessários para saída pronta para produção.

Criar e pagar pedidos

Envie payloads de pedido e conclua pagamentos através dos endpoints de pedido para fechar o fluxo de transação.

Fluxo de integração da API

Da primeira chamada autenticada ao pedido pago, este caminho de quatro etapas reflete como nossas APIs são agrupadas na documentação: acesso seguro, ativos de imagem, designs imprimíveis e depois checkout e pagamento. Trate cada etapa como um ponto de verificação para que seu backend permaneça previsível e fácil de depurar.

Estação de trabalho de desenvolvedor mostrando autenticação de API e configuração segura de credenciais.
01

Configurar assinatura e autenticação

Leia os capítulos sobre assinatura e autenticação, emita ou importe as credenciais necessárias para seu ambiente e implemente a assinatura exatamente conforme especificado. Envie algumas solicitações de teste de baixo risco e confirme que recebe respostas bem-sucedidas antes de prosseguir com uploads -- quando a autenticação é sólida, erros posteriores quase sempre apontam para a estrutura do payload em vez de misteriosos erros 401.

02

Fazer upload das imagens que seus produtos precisam

Use os endpoints de imagem para fazer upload de logotipos, artes ou outros arquivos que sua integração requer. Armazene cada identificador retornado na resposta da API para poder passar esses valores para solicitações de design subsequentes, na mesma forma mostrada nos exemplos de solicitação.

Fazendo upload de ativos de imagem para a plataforma através de uma interface desktop.
Designer criando mockups de produtos e dados de design em um espaço de trabalho criativo.
03

Criar e persistir registros de design

Chame os endpoints de design para criar registros de design que combinam produtos, posicionamentos e referências de imagem da etapa anterior. Mantenha os identificadores de design retornados em seu sistema para que os payloads de pedido possam referenciá-los, conforme descrito na seção Pedido da documentação.

04

Enviar pedido e finalizar pagamento

Envie pedidos através dos endpoints de pedido usando os identificadores de design armazenados. Conclua o pagamento seguindo as etapas documentadas para os endpoints relacionados ao pagamento. Respostas, códigos de status e corpos de erro na documentação são autoritativos -- não confie em comportamentos que não estão descritos lá.

Concluindo checkout de pedido e pagamento com cartão em um laptop.

Além do caminho de integração principal

A documentação oficial da API também agrupa Produto, Geral, FAQ e Changelog junto com Autenticação, Imagem, Design e Pedido. Use estas seções quando precisar de dados de catálogo, utilitários compartilhados ou histórico de versões que o fluxo principal não cobre por si só.

  • Produto

    Os endpoints de Produto descrevem como consultar itens de catálogo, variantes e opções que se combinam com designs e pedidos. Consulte-os quando precisar resolver IDs de produto ou atributos antes de construir um payload.

  • Geral

    A seção Geral cobre utilitários e solicitações transversais que acompanham chamadas de imagem, design e pedido. Verifique a referência quando precisar de operações auxiliares documentadas lá.

  • FAQ e Changelog

    Leia o FAQ para perguntas comuns de integração e use o Changelog para rastrear atualizações da API, adições e quaisquer mudanças incompatíveis ao longo do tempo.

Equipe revisando documentação da API em uma tela grande em um escritório moderno.

Casos de uso comuns da API

Padrões de implementação típicos baseados em capacidades de imagem, design e pedido.

Pipeline de design automatizado

Faça upload de imagens em lotes e gere designs programaticamente para acelerar a produção de conteúdo.

Serviço de envio de pedidos

Construa um serviço backend que converte dados de checkout em solicitações de pedido padronizadas.

Fluxo de conclusão de pagamento

Conecte endpoints de criação de pedido e pagamento em uma sequência de transação controlada com tratamento claro de status.

Recursos para equipes

Use documentação e canais de suporte para acelerar desenvolvimento e rollout.

Documentação para desenvolvedores

Revise grupos de endpoints, detalhes de autenticação e exemplos de payload para operações de imagem, design e pedido.

Abrir documentação

Suporte técnico

Entre em contato com a equipe PrintKK para perguntas de implementação e solução de problemas de integração.

FAQ da API

O que devemos implementar primeiro?

Comece com assinatura e autenticação para que cada solicitação subsequente de imagem, design e pedido seja verificável e segura.

Quais operações principais são suportadas?

As operações principais documentadas são upload de imagens, criação de designs, criação de pedidos e pagamento de pedidos.

Como devemos estruturar a sequência de chamadas?

Use um fluxo linear: autenticar solicitações, fazer upload de imagens, criar designs, criar pedidos e depois concluir pagamento.

Onde podemos encontrar detalhes das solicitações?

Consulte a documentação da API para parâmetros de endpoint, exemplos de solicitação e notas de implementação específicas de seção.

Comece a integrar hoje

Abra a documentação da API para ver regras de assinatura, parâmetros de endpoint e exemplos de solicitação para cada funcionalidade.